Salisbury Road between Nathan and Chatham Roads was widened to conform to the approved Laying-out Scheme, kerbed, channelled and surfaced with ordinary macadam and tar painted.

Argyle Street between Nathan Road and Ho Man Tin was widened to the full width on the North side of Nullah, kerbed and channeled and surfaced with ordinary macadam and tar painted.

(e) General Works.--The Following is a brief statement of the principal works carried out under this heading :-

The main 100-foot road between Kowloon City Reclamation and Ma Tau Wei Village was macadamized throughout for a width of 16 feet in the centre.

A portion of Hankow Road was widened to the new alignment, kerbed, channelled, macadamized and tar painted.

The following roads were kerbed and channelled, the footpaths being paved with granolithic slabs and any necessary improvements being made in front of new buildings erected during the year :--

Bowring Street, from Shanghai Street to Nathan Road, Ningpo Street, from Woosung Road, Chatham Road, Canton Road, Woosung Street, Parkes Street, Portland Street, Market Street, Street between Nathan Road and Jordan Road, Nathan Road, New Street, from Bowring Street to Austin Road, Pine Street, Ho Mun Tin, Shanghai Street, Reclamation Street, Kimberley Road, Observatory Road, Ivy Street, Austin Road, Ningpo Street, Jordan Road, Battery Street, Temple Street and Dundas Street

Jordan Road, Battery Street, Temple Street and Dundas Street were all raised to approved levels.

1921 Estimates, $50,000.00

1921 Expenditure, $42,044.11
